孕前应激诱导的产后抑郁模型小鼠海马精神分裂症断裂基因1的表达变化 被引量:8

Expression of Disrupted-in-schizophrenia 1 in Hippocampus in Postpartum Depression Animal Models Induced by Pre-pregnancy Stress

摘要 目的以孕前应激诱导方式建立产后抑郁症(PPD)小鼠模型,评估母鼠产后的异常行为,检测母鼠海马精神分裂症断裂基因1(DISC1)及血清雌二醇、皮质酮的变化,揭示产后抑郁的发病机制。方法将32只Balb/c母鼠采用随机数字表法分为对照组和模型组,每组16只,对照组小鼠不给予任何刺激,模型组小鼠给予慢性束缚刺激。3周后对照组和模型组均予雌雄合笼交配怀孕,分娩后即为对照组和孕前应激诱导PPD模型组。于分娩后3周对母鼠进行旷场测试、悬尾测试及糖水偏爱测试以评价造模是否成功。取海马检测DISC1基因及蛋白的表达,眼眶取血检测血清雌二醇及皮质酮水平。结果产后3周,与对照组相比,PPD模型组在旷场测试中自发活动无改变(P>0.05),在悬尾测试中的绝望不动时间显著增加(t=-4.950,P<0.001),糖水偏爱显著降低(t=2.475,P<0.05)。与对照组相比,PPD模型组海马DISC1基因(t=-8.915,P<0.001)及蛋白(t=-5.004,P<0.01)表达均显著上调,而血清皮质酮及雌二醇均无变化(P均>0.05)。结论慢性孕前应激可诱导Balb/c母鼠表现出产后抑郁样症状,其发病机制可能与调控海马DISC1的基因和蛋白表达有关。 Objective To establish a postpartum depression animal model induced by pre-pregnancy stress,assess abnormal maternal depressive-like behavior,observe the expression of disrupted-in-schizophrenia 1( DISC1) in the hippocampus,and detect serum estradiol and corticosterone. Methods A total of 32 female Balb/c were assigned to two groups using random number table: the control group and the pre-pregnancy stressed group( model group),and the model group was subjected to 3 weeks of chronic restraint stress. After the last stressor,the control group and the model group were housed with a male. About 4 weeks later,the mice gave birth to pups. Then at 3 weeks postpartum,open field test,tail suspension test,and sucrose preference test were carried out. The expressions of DISC1 mRNA and protein of hippocampus were detected by real-time quantitative polymerase chain reaction and Western blot,respectively. The serum levels of estradiol and corticosterone were detected with enzyme linked immunosorbent assay. Results After 3 weeks of postpartum,the model mice showed depression-like behaviors. In the open field test,there was no effect on the total distance moved or time spent in the center field( P〉0. 05). Immobility in tail suspension test was significantly increased( t =-4. 950,P〈0. 001) and sucrose preference was significantly reduced in model group( t = 2. 475,P〈0. 05).There was significant statistical difference between control and model group on the expression of DISC1 mRNA( t =-8. 915,P〈0. 001) and protein( t =-5. 004,P〈0. 01) in hippocampus. There was no significant statistical difference on estradiol and corticosterone between two groups( P〉0. 05). Conclusions Chronic prepregnancy stress can induce dams into postpartum depression. The pathogenesis of postpartum depression may be related to the regulation of DISC1 in the hippocampus.
